In the learning process, not every student succeeds through the learning process carried out, in other words, not every student can achieve the learning objectives as expected, there are still many students who are less successful. In the process and learning outcomes can be successful or not influenced by many factors, including intelligence, readiness to learn, interest, motivation, teacher ability, maturity, family, school and community. Teaching aids in the teaching and learning process can generate desire and interest, generate motivation, stimulate learning activities and even psychological influence on students. The author in this study uses quantitative descriptive methods, data analysis using statistical formulas. The population in this study were all students of class X SMA Perintis 1 Bandar Lampung which consisted of 9 classes with a total of 398 students, while the sample was taken 2 classes, namely X.2 as the experimental class and X.3 as the control class. . Test the hypothesis by using the statistical formula t-test. From the results of hypothesis testing using the statistical formula t-test, the value of t = 4.62 is obtained. From the t distribution table at the 5% significant level, it is known that t = t = 1.993 and t = 1.67, while at the 1% significant level it is known that t = t = 2.65 and t = 2.39, this means t > t. So with this it can be said that there is an effect of the use of teaching aids on the mathematics learning outcomes of X SMA Perintis 1 Bandar Lampung students and the average mathematics learning outcomes of students who use teaching aids are higher than the average learning outcomes of students who do not use teaching aids. Thus, it can be said that the use of teaching aids is positive or can improve mathematics learning outcomes.
